Summary

Begin your adventure on a 340 meter (1246 ft.) long zip line cable which begins at an 18 meter (59 ft.) high tower and then crosses the spectacular canyon to a platform anchored in the middle of the splendid tropical rainforest with all of its magnificent biodiversity. The rappel is an 80 meter (262 ft.) descent alongside the Pino Blanco Waterfall. You will descend 30 meters (98 ft.) in free fall, then rappel the final 50 meters (164 ft.) along a lush green canyon wall. After the descending, you climb back up on a perpendicular cable ladder, followed by another zip line cable to the Pino Blanco lookout point. Once we return, we will visit the Maleku Indian Cultural Rescue Center, to learn about their traditions and cultural roots, as well as how we can help to protect this, one of the smallest ethnic groups found in Costa Rica.

About operator:

We are Located in La Fortuna, San Carlos, Costa Rica, 1.5 km (1 mile) south of the Catholic Church, we have been declared a Tropical Ecological Park, and have a wide array of natural, cultural, and adventure tours which promise visitors unforgettable one-of-a-kind experiences in Costa Rica. Arenal Mundo Aventura was created through the dreams and plans of 4 business partners, and opened its doors in 2005. The primary objective is and was to conserve the rainforest and the environment, combining that with ecotourism and responsible adventure tourism. With this project we have managed to reforest a large amount of land, of which we currently only use 10% in our daily operations.
